TEAM & ROLE

Benepass is building financial infrastructure that powers how companies fund, control, and deliver benefits globally.

We are hiring a Senior Software Engineer to own and evolve the systems at the core of our platform: ledgering, transaction processing, decisioning, and money movement. These systems are responsible for tracking and moving real funds, enforcing complex rules, and maintaining a precise and auditable source of truth.

This is not a typical backend role. You will be working on high-integrity financial systems where correctness, consistency, and reliability matter more than raw throughput - and where small mistakes can have real financial impact.

This role is ideal for engineers who have built or operated systems in payments, card issuing, wallets, banking infrastructure, or global money movement platforms, and want to take end-to-end ownership of a growing fintech layer.

You will
  • Design and operate systems responsible for:
    • Ledgering (double-entry systems, balances, transaction history, reconciliation)
    • Transaction processing pipelines (authorization, capture, settlement flows)
    • Real-time decisioning (spend controls, eligibility, rules engines)
    • Money movement, including support for multi-currency and global transactions
  • Build systems that are correct by design:
    • Define and always maintain invariants to ensure correctness under all operational conditions
    • Idempotent
    • Strongly consistent where required
    • Fully auditable
  • Own the lifecycle of financial transactions end-to-end, including:
    • State transitions
    • Failure handling and retries
    • Reconciliation and reporting
  • Integrate with external financial partners (processors, banks, networks) and handle unreliable and asynchronous dependencies
  • Lead architectural decisions and write technical approach documents that clarify trade-offs and long-term implications
  • Improve system resilience, observability, and operational tooling as volume and complexity grow
  • Mentor other engineers and help define best practices for building financial systems

REQUIREMENTS
  • Experience building or operating financial systems such as payments, card issuing, wallets, or banking infrastructure
  • Deep understanding of fintech and payments ecosystems, including:
    • Card network fundamentals (e.g., ISO 8583 messaging, authorization/clearing/settlement flows)
    • Merchant acquiring and payment processor flows
    • How issuers, sponsor banks, and processor integrations work in practice
    • Familiarity with real-world transaction lifecycles across the stack (network 12 processor 12 ledger)
  • Experience designing or working on a ledger system, including:
    • Double-entry accounting concepts
    • Transaction lifecycles
    • Balance correctness and reconciliation
  • Experience building decisioning systems in production (e.g., transaction authorization, rules engines), ideally in real-time or latency-sensitive contexts
  • Experience working on systems that handle real money at scale (thousands of transactions per day or more)
  • Experience with global money movement, including:
    • Multi-currency systems
    • Currency conversion or FX considerations
    • Cross-border transactions (nice to have but strongly preferred)
  • Strong understanding of:
    • Data consistency and correctness
    • Idempotency and safe retries
    • Failure modes in distributed systems
  • Experience integrating with external financial APIs, including handling partial failures, timeouts, and eventual consistency
  • Proficiency in Python and relational databases (PostgreSQL preferred)

About Benepass

Benepass is a San Francisco-based company that provides a platform for employers to offer customizable employee benefits packages. The company's platform allows employers to offer a range of benefits, including health insurance, retirement plans, and wellness programs, all in one place. Benepass aims to simplify the process of offering employee benefits, making it easier for employers to attract and retain top talent. The company was founded in 2018 by Veer Gidwaney and Prasad Thammineni.
